Output ec65433b7f583116174a05032851c498080807dc837e17f96fa807ce5622e435:1

value
3988091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cfdbfe29174a5710f9ac91ec25f79ce1aa218be OP_EQUAL
address
3D5uhA9pkvpreXB9AkQMq6Yur8teT4ua2L
transaction
ec65433b7f583116174a05032851c498080807dc837e17f96fa807ce5622e435
spent
true